- Story Text: Beauval Zoo in central France welcomed the birth of two baby pandas early on Monday.
Female panda Huan Huan was cheered by zoo staff as they watched surveillance camera footage of her giving birth and later holding her babies.
Zoo head veterinarian Baptiste Mulot said the cubs seemed to be in good shape and said the birth was an "incredible moment."
Huan Huan and her partner Yuan Zi came to France on loan from China in 2012, and their arrival was hailed at the time as a sign of warming diplomatic ties between Paris and Beijing.
While an adult female panda can weigh up to 125 kilograms (275 pounds), a baby panda weighs barely 120 grams (4 ounces) at birth.
